The kingdom has fallen and settlers take sales to new lands. They arrive to archipelago. Now they need to find space on it for everyone. Fight monsters, acquire new territories. But mostly important – find place to live for everyone.ScreenShot.JPG

How to Play: 1. Click on the island to take control. Empty (grey) islands are taken immediately. Enemy (red) islands require from you to put equal (or more) number of settlers to the number of enemies their. You may increase number of settlers of enemy island to increase speed of take over. 2. Islands, cleared from enemies, will produce food as well. 3. There is panic level among settler. You will increase panic 1) for each enemy island which is connected to your islands (green) and 2) if amount of food produced is less then number of settlers. If panic level is maxed - you loose. 4. Every 5 seconds 5 settlers arrive. If you manage to keep panic level below max when all 50 of settlers arrive - you win.

Known bugs: 1. If you stay on initial island, you will win. It is balance problem. 2. You may place more settlers on enemy islands, that you actually have
